4 Activities to DO After Embryo Transfer
- Pamper Yourself
The most important activity that you can do is to do nothing! Post-transfer, taking proper rest is the key. While you do not have to lie down on your bed 24/7, avoid overexertion. Being the best IVF hospital in Gurgaon, we suggest keeping things low-key during this period.
- Stay Hyderated
Water is your best friend right now. Proper hydration not only boosts blood circulation in your uterus but also regulates hormones. At Yellow IVF, your trusted IVF centre in Gurgaon, we say try taking 2 to 3 litres of water every day, depending on your body and needs. You can add a slice of lemon or cucumber to bring a refreshing twist to your drinking.
- Eat a Nutritious Meal
After getting your embryo transferred, focus on a balanced diet rich in leafy vegetables, whole grains, fresh fruits, and lean proteins. A nutritious diet fuels your body and aids in embryo implantation. Ensure to eat a proportionate meal with leafy veggies, whole grains, and lean proteins. 4 Activities to AVOID After Embryo Transfer
- No More Heavy Lifting
You can save the squats for later. Heavy lifting and high-impact, intense workouts can affect implantation, posing a serious threat to the embryo. Ensure to talk to the fertility experts at Yellow IVF, the best IVF hospitals in Gurgaon, to understand which activities are post-transfer suitable.
- Stay Far From Stress
Stress increases cortisol in our bodies, which can impact fertility. Once you have your embryo transfer, say no to drama, deadlines, and doomscrolling. Instead, try binge-watching your favourite romcoms or a feel-good movie to be happy and keep your embryo healthy.
- Put a Pin in the Passion
Sexual intimacy is a big no-no during this phase. Intercourse can trigger uterine contractions, which you want to avoid after embryo transfer. In worst cases, intercourse can prevent implantation, leading to miscarriages. Try spending more time with yourself and remember, this pause is temporary.
- Say Bye to Puffs and Pours
Smoking and consuming alcohol are strictly off-limits after embryo transfer. They reduce implantation chances and hinder the embryo development process.
